Indie Author Training, the education arm of Athenia Creative Services’ publishing ecosystem, has completed a full platform relaunch, unifying the learning experience with sister community Wide For The Win.
The redesigned platform at IndieAuthorTraining.com now hosts 105 instructors and features a refreshed interface, integrated community spaces, and improved course delivery tools. The migration brings Indie Author Training onto the same FluentCommunity platform that powers Wide For The Win, creating a consistent experience for author-partners across both properties.
Leading the instructor roster is bestselling author Joe Nassise with two flagship courses: StoryEngines and StoryCraft.
“We wanted our instructors and students to have the same campus experience whether they’re learning on Indie Author Training or connecting with peers on Wide For The Win,” said Chelle Honiker, Managing Partner of Athenia Creative Services. “Matching the platforms means author-partners can move between education and community without friction.”
The platform consolidation reflects Athenia Creative’s broader strategy of connecting its ecosystem of brands. Indie Author Magazine provides industry awareness, Indie Author Training delivers structured education, and Wide For The Win offers peer connection for authors who distribute beyond Amazon exclusivity.
